Active Analog Subwoofer


For deep, precise bass that transforms your sound, the ELEPHANT is your ultimate choice. Designed for both professional engineers and home studio enthusiasts, this analog, active subwoofer delivers powerful, articulate low-end performance that’s perfect for recording, mixing, music production, or just enjoying immersive sound at home. Its sealed enclosure ensures tight bass response without muddiness, while the all-analog design adds warmth and depth to your listening experience. From pro studios to home setups, ELEPHANT takes your sound to the next level.

Input (Analog) : Balanced XLR or Unbalanced RCA

Output (Through-Analog) : 2 Channels Balanced XLR or 2 Channels Unbalanced RCA
Frequency Response: 20 - 300 Hz


Enclosure type: Sealed
Crossover type: Active, Analog
Crossover Frequency: User Controllable (30-300Hz, Second Order LP, Phase: 0-360°)
Peak SPL: 110.5 dB

Woofer: 32 cm / 12.5” - Paper Sandwich Cone with patented foam filling

Amplifiers: 2 (Bridged)
Amplifier Type: Class D
Amplifier Power: 2 x 500 W

Power Rating Max: 1200 Watts
Power Rating RMS: 480 Watts

Min Voltage: 110-120 Volts
Max Voltage: 200-240 Volts 

Voltage Frequency: 47-63 Hz
AC Connector: 3-pin IEC 250 Volts AC, 10A Male

Weight: 38 Kg (83.8 lbs)

Dimensions: 43 x 44 x 52.5 cm (HxWxD)

Stand By: User controllable (On 120 min / Off)
